Released in 1935, Jalna is a drama and romance film directed by John Cromwell, running about 78 minutes.

What it’s about. A young poet, accompanied by his new bride, returns home to his large family at their Canadian farm.

Who’s in it. Jalna stars Kay Johnson as Alayne Whiteoaks, Ian Hunter as Renny Whiteoaks, C. Aubrey Smith as Nicholas Whiteoaks and Nigel Bruce as Maurice Vaughn, among others.
